Block 510,072
Block Hash
b569de1daf570d7828a7f9660621800e1baf90e51dea6f98a511f076a8dc84e8
Previous Block Hash
4742406a108283da7d71c902a2fef78c9f8c0db92d9850679a2cf6de634d1872
Mined
Transactions
3
Difficulty
37.92 M
Size
624 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
834.8925
PEPE
1 input, 2 outputs
830.89024
PEPE